Position Summary Manufacturing Engineers work collaboratively with Design Engineering (new product development and existing products) and Manufacturing Operations. They implement manufacturing processes and systems to meet manufacturing goals and objectives such as improved safety and environmental performance, improved quality, reduced cost and meeting scheduled customer deliveries. They provide direct support to company Lean/Continuous Improvement initiatives and are also responsible to investigate, understand, and apply the appropriate new manufacturing technologies while always maintaining alignment to defined company core competencies. In addition, this position provides engineering compliance support for Kinze commercial hydraulic/hangar door products and installations, including validation of wind-load and other code-driven design criteria. Kinzes door designs are used for commercial, aviation, and agricultural installations.
